Shower Floor Tiling in Denver County, CO

Shower floor tiling services involve installing durable and water-resistant tiles on the surface of a shower’s floor. These projects typically include replacing outdated or damaged tiles, upgrading to new styles, or creating a cohesive look with surrounding bathroom features. Homeowners often seek this service to improve the appearance of their shower area, prevent water leaks, and enhance overall bathroom functionality. It’s important to consider the type of tile material, slip resistance, and drainage options to ensure a safe and long-lasting installation.

Property owners interested in shower floor tiling should understand the scope of work involved, including surface preparation, tile selection, and grout application. They may also want to inquire about the best tile options for wet environments, maintenance requirements, and the overall durability of different materials. Clarifying these details beforehand can help ensure the project meets expectations and provides a functional, attractive shower space that withstands daily use.

FAQ

Shower Floor Tiling Questions

What types of tile are suitable for shower floors? Porcelain and ceramic tiles are popular choices due to their durability and water resistance, making them ideal for shower floors.

How are shower floor tiles installed? Installation involves preparing the surface, applying mortar, setting the tiles with proper spacing, and sealing the grout to prevent water penetration.

What should be considered when choosing a tile pattern for the shower floor? Slip resistance and ease of cleaning are important factors; textured tiles and smaller sizes can improve safety and maintenance.

Can existing shower floors be retiled? Yes, existing tiles can often be removed and replaced, provided the underlying surface is in good condition for new tile installation.
